After 13 years at Leicester City, Jamie Vardy has decided to close that chapter and is now ready to face a new challenge. His departure has generated great interest, and several teams have already inquired about him to strengthen their squads.
Over six clubs from different countries are interested in signing the forward, who will arrive on a free transfer. This makes him a very attractive option for many teams.
The 6 teams interested in signing Jamie Vardy.
In Spain, both Valencia CF and Villarreal CF have shown interest in having Vardy to add experience and goals up front. In England, Leeds United has also shown interest in reinforcing their attack.
Moreover, in the United States and Austria, Red Bull group teams have set their sights on him: Red Bull New York in the MLS and RB Salzburg in the Austrian Bundesliga. These two clubs belong to the same franchise, which could facilitate his arrival at either of them, depending on the project they offer him.
In addition, Charlotte FC, another MLS club, is also keeping an eye on the English forward and considers him a key piece for their aspirations.
At 38 years old, Vardy wants to prove he still has a lot to offer and is looking for a team that will provide him with a leading role and a good sports project.
The interested clubs will need to convince him with attractive proposals, both in terms of sports and economics, for him to decide where he will continue his career.
